The main application for aqua regia is in the Wohlwill process, a chemical procedure that is used to refine gold. Aqua regia is used in this way to produce chloroauric acid, which plays an important role in this gold-refining technique. The result of the Wohlwill process is high purity gold (99.999%).

The aqua regia refining process is used to refine gold alloys using a combination of acids and chemical products. The aqua regia solution consists of a mixture of hydrochloric acid HCL and nitric acid HNO 3. Best suited for gold with an initial purity of at least 600/1000.

Sep 12, 2009 Aqua regia dissolves gold, though neither constituent acid will do so alone, because, in combination, each acid performs a different task. Nitric acid is a powerful oxidizer, which will actually dissolve a virtually undetectable amount of gold, forming gold ions (Au3+). Oct 20, 2015 How To Use Aqua Regia To Purify Gold. Place your gold or finely powdered ore in a Pyrex container breaker. Mix 1 part nitric acid to 3 parts hydrochloric acid in a separate glass or plastic container. When mixing the acids together, use great caution!
Free nitrogen ions that are in solution are neutralized by the addition of urea. A selective precipitant is added to turn the dissolved gold (and nothing else) back into solid form (particles). The solution is either decanted or filtered to recover the pure gold mud. The gold mud is then rinsed, dried and melted.
Nov 03, 2016 A platinum manufacturers separateS platinum from gold by dissolving in aqua regia, driving off acids, and precipitating the platinum with ammonium chloride. At Freiberg, platiniferous gold is purified by melting with twice its weight of sodium bisulphate, and subsequently with a little nitre.
